From the real world to the virtual, Modhesh is everywhere, but his journey to DSS 2013 has been particularly eventful

Modhesh has been making sporadic appearances on the Facebook page of Summer Is Dubai, which was launched this March. However, the couple of instances of Modhesh-spotting have gone down really well with audiences generating more than 250 Likes.
Not just children but grown-ups also give a thumbs up to the mascot who was spotted walking around Atlantis The Palm this April, before making an appearance at the Arabian Travel Market in May. The character is popular around the region and travels on goodwill visits to hospitals and schools in the GCC, where Modhesh is seen as an ambassador of Dubai.

Children of all nationalities visit Modhesh World, one of the region’s largest indoor-entertainment venues over the summer. More than 500,000 children have visited the pop-up venue over the years.

Much has happened in Modhesh’s life since the last edition of Dubai Summer Surprises (DSS). In November last year Dubai Events and Promotions Establishment (DEPE), as the licensor of Modhesh was then called, announced a strategic alliance with Mondo TV, a European animation production and distribution company to produce and distribute an animated cartoon series on Modhesh worldwide. The character’s parent company is now rechristened Dubai Festivals and Retail Sector Promotions Establishment, but its status as the region’s most popular character remains unchanged.

The character was created as the mascot for DSS making his first appearance in 2000 in a TV advertisement for DSS. He popped out as a jack-in-the-box screaming “Surprise!”
